The Invisalign Treatment Process Explained
Initial Consultation and Assessment
The Invisalign process kicks off with a detailed examination of your teeth. During this stage, your orthodontist will discuss your lifestyle and treatment goals to see if Invisalign is the right fit for you. They might take X-rays, photos, or even a 3D scan of your teeth to get a clear picture of your dental structure. This step is crucial because it sets the foundation for your entire treatment plan. The Invisalign process starts with understanding your unique needs, ensuring a tailored approach.
Customizing Your Invisalign Aligners
Once your orthodontist has all the necessary information, they’ll design a custom treatment plan just for you. This includes creating a series of aligners that gradually shift your teeth into the desired position. Each aligner is made from clear, medical-grade plastic, ensuring both comfort and invisibility. You’ll typically wear each set for about two weeks before moving on to the next. What’s cool is that you can actually preview your expected results using advanced 3D imaging software before you even start.
Tracking Your Progress with Invisalign
Throughout your treatment, regular check-ins with your orthodontist are essential. These appointments usually happen every six to eight weeks and allow your specialist to monitor your progress and make any necessary adjustments. It’s a straightforward process—just pop in, get evaluated, and pick up your next set of aligners. Understanding the Cost of Invisalign
The price of Invisalign treatments can vary depending on the complexity of your dental needs. On average, Invisalign in Hamilton can cost between $3,000 and $7,000. Factors like the number of aligners required and the duration of treatment will influence the final cost. It’s worth noting that Invisalign is often comparable in price to traditional braces, making it an appealing choice for many.
Insurance Coverage for Invisalign Treatments
Many insurance plans include orthodontic benefits that may partially cover Invisalign treatments. It’s a good idea to check with your provider to see if your plan includes coverage for clear aligners. Typically, insurance can cover up to 50% of the treatment cost, but this varies. Don’t forget to ask your dentist for a detailed invoice to submit to your insurance company.

Caring for Your Invisalign Aligners
Cleaning and Maintenance Tips
Keeping your Invisalign aligners clean is super important—not just for your teeth, but for your overall oral health. Here’s what you need to do:
- Brush and floss your teeth before putting your aligners back in. This helps avoid trapping food particles and bacteria.
- Use lukewarm water and a soft toothbrush to gently clean your aligners. Don’t use hot water; it can warp the plastic.
- Consider using Invisalign cleaning crystals or a mild soap to give them a deeper clean.
If you’re not careful, your aligners can pick up stains or odors. A little effort goes a long way in keeping them fresh.
Dos and Don’ts for Invisalign Wearers
Wearing Invisalign aligners is straightforward, but there are a few things to keep in mind:
Dos:
- Wear your aligners for 20-22 hours a day for the best results.
- Store them in their case when not in use to avoid losing them.
- Rinse your aligners every time you take them out.
Don’ts:
- Don’t eat or drink anything other than water while wearing your aligners. Stains and damage can happen easily.
- Avoid using toothpaste to clean them—it’s too abrasive.
- Don’t leave them exposed to air for long periods; bacteria can build up.
What to Do If You Lose or Damage an Aligner
Losing or damaging an aligner can feel like a disaster, but don’t panic. Here’s what you should do:
- Contact your Invisalign provider immediately. They’ll guide you on the next steps.
- If you have a previous set, you can wear those temporarily to keep your teeth from shifting.

Common Misconceptions About Invisalign
Myths About Invisalign Effectiveness
One of the biggest misunderstandings about Invisalign is that it’s only good for minor teeth adjustments. This couldn’t be further from the truth. Invisalign aligners are designed to tackle a wide range of orthodontic problems, from slight gaps to more complex alignment issues. In fact, many patients are surprised to learn that Invisalign can handle cases like overbites, underbites, and even crossbites. If you’ve ever thought Invisalign wasn’t for you, it might be time to reconsider.
Addressing Concerns About Comfort and Appearance
Some people worry that wearing Invisalign will be uncomfortable or too noticeable. The reality? These aligners are made of smooth, medical-grade plastic that’s much more comfortable than traditional braces. Plus, they’re virtually invisible, so most people won’t even know you’re wearing them. Sure, there’s a short adjustment period, but that’s true for any orthodontic treatment. Once you get used to them, you might even forget they’re there!
Clarifying the Timeline for Results
Another common myth is that Invisalign takes longer to work than traditional braces. While every case is unique, the average treatment time for Invisalign is comparable to, if not shorter than, braces. Most people start seeing results in just a few months, which can be incredibly motivating. And because you’ll visit your dentist regularly to track your progress, you’ll have a clear idea of how your treatment is going every step of the way.

Frequently Asked Questions
What makes Invisalign different from regular braces?
Invisalign uses clear, plastic trays to straighten your teeth instead of metal wires and brackets. They’re almost invisible and can be removed when eating or brushing.
Is Invisalign suitable for kids and adults?
Yes, Invisalign works for both kids and adults. It’s designed to fix many dental problems, no matter your age.
How long does Invisalign treatment take?
The treatment time depends on your dental needs, but most people wear Invisalign for 12 to 18 months to see results.
Can I eat whatever I want with Invisalign?
Yes! Since you can take out your aligners, you can eat all your favorite foods. Just remember to put them back in after eating.
Does Invisalign hurt?
You might feel some pressure or discomfort when you switch to a new aligner, but it’s usually mild and goes away quickly.
What happens if I lose an aligner?
If you lose an aligner, contact your dentist or orthodontist right away. They might suggest you use your previous aligner or move on to the next one.
